Abstract

【課題】捺印が消えないで長もちすることができ、平面度の少し悪い部位にも正確に捺印でき、コンパクトにまとめられる不滅インクを用いた手動捺印用スタンプを提供する。【解決手段】不滅インクを用いた手動捺印用スタンプは捺印用のパッド4と該パッド4に不滅インク10を供給する印字側ホルダ1と該印字側ホルダ1を保持する保持側ホルダとからなり印字側ホルダ1の端面を被捺印部に押し当ててパッド4により捺印を行う。【選択図】図3To provide a stamp for manual stamping using immortal ink that can be stamped without being erased, can be accurately stamped even at a slightly poor flatness, and can be compactly integrated. A stamp for manual imprinting using immortal ink is composed of a pad 4 for imprinting, a printing side holder 1 for supplying immortal ink 10 to the pad 4, and a holding side holder for holding the printing side holder 1. The end surface of the side holder 1 is pressed against the part to be marked, and printing is performed with the pad 4. [Selection] Figure 3

Description

本考案は、捺印用のスタンプに係り、特に不滅インクを用いた印字の消滅のない不滅インクを用いた手動捺印用スタンプに関する。   The present invention relates to a stamp for stamping, and more particularly to a stamp for manual stamping using immortal ink that does not lose its print using immortal ink.

スタンプとしては数多くの各種のものが開発され、かつ使用されているが、インクとして不滅インクを用いるスタンプとしては、例えば「特許文献1」が挙げられる。   Many kinds of stamps have been developed and used. As a stamp using immortal ink as an ink, for example, “Patent Document 1” can be cited.

特開平11−58911号(図1)Japanese Patent Laid-Open No. 11-58911 (FIG. 1)

「特許文献1」の「特開平11−58911号」の「捺印装置」は不滅インクを使用したスタンプであるが、その特徴としては不滅インクの取扱を容易にするものであり、後に説明する本考案のスタンプとは構成や目的が相異するものである。   The “printing apparatus” of “Japanese Patent Laid-Open No. 11-58911” of “Patent Document 1” is a stamp that uses immortal ink, and its feature is that it facilitates the handling of immortal ink. The devised stamp has a different structure and purpose.

スタンプとしては前記のように各種のものがあるが、通常スタンプとしては構造がコンパクトであり、捺印が正確に出来、被捺印部の平面度が少し悪いものに対しても捺印が明確に出来、かつ捺印されたものが消えないものであることが望まれる。また、不滅インクの注入が容易であり、不滅インクの捺印用のパッドへの供給が確実に行われ、かつ不滅インクの使用量が少なくて済むものであることが望ましい。   There are various types of stamps as described above, but the structure is usually compact as a stamp, the stamping can be performed accurately, and the stamping can be clearly made even when the flatness of the portion to be stamped is slightly poor, In addition, it is desirable that the stamped one does not disappear. In addition, it is desirable that the immortal ink can be easily injected, the immortal ink can be reliably supplied to the stamp pad, and the amount of the immortal ink used can be reduced.

本考案のスタンプは以上の事情に鑑みて考案されたものであり、不滅インクの注入が容易であり、パッドへの供給が安定、かつ確実に行われると共に平面度の多少悪い被捺印部に対しても正確な捺印ができ、捺印後の捺印が消え難く、全体としてコンパクトに形成される不滅インクを用いた手動捺印用スタンプを提供することを目的とする。   The stamp of the present invention has been devised in view of the above circumstances, and it is easy to inject immortal ink, and the supply to the pad is stable and reliable, and the printed part has a slightly poor flatness. However, it is an object of the present invention to provide a stamp for manual stamping using immortal ink which can be accurately stamped and hardly stamped after stamping and is formed compact as a whole.

本考案は、以上の目的を達成するために、請求項1の考案は、所望の捺印を行うための手動のスタンプであって、該スタンプは不滅インクを収納する印字側ホルダと、該印字側ホルダが挿入保持される保持側ホルダとの組み合わせ体からなり、前記印字側ホルダは捺印用のパッドが挿入保持されるパッド挿入保持孔部と、該パッド挿入保持孔部と前記不滅インクの収納されている部位との間に介設され前記不滅インクを前記パッドの側に湿出すためのインクパッドとを有するものからなることを特徴とする。   In order to achieve the above-mentioned object, the present invention provides a manual stamp for performing a desired stamp, wherein the stamp is a print side holder for storing immortal ink, and the print side. The printing side holder includes a pad insertion holding hole portion into which a pad for printing is inserted and held, and the pad insertion holding hole portion and the immortal ink are stored in the printing side holder. And an ink pad for wetting out the immortal ink to the side of the pad.

また、請求項2の考案は、前記印字側ホルダの前記パッド側の端面には前記パッド挿入保持孔部の形成されている端面より出っ張る周縁突出面が形成され、前記周縁突出面の端面と前記パッドの挿入端側の端面とが略同一面に形成されることを特徴とする。   Further, the invention of claim 2 is that a pad-side end surface of the print-side holder is formed with a peripheral protruding surface protruding from an end surface where the pad insertion holding hole portion is formed, and the end surface of the peripheral protruding surface and the end surface The pad insertion end side end surface is formed in substantially the same plane.

また、請求項3の考案は、前記印字側ホルダは、前記保持側ホルダに着脱可能に保持されるキャップにより被包されることを特徴とする。   The invention of claim 3 is characterized in that the printing side holder is encapsulated by a cap that is detachably held by the holding side holder.

本考案の請求項1の不滅インクを用いた手動捺印用スタンプによれば、構成としては印字側ホルダとこれが挿入される保持側ホルダとの組み合わせからなるコンパクトの構造のものからなり、各種の捺印用のパッドの挿入が容易にでき、不滅インクの挿入も容易であり、使用量も少なくて済み、パッドへの不滅インクの供給も正確にできる効果を上げることがきる。   According to the stamp for manual stamping using immortal ink according to claim 1 of the present invention, the stamping stamp has a compact structure composed of a combination of a printing side holder and a holding side holder into which it is inserted. The pad can be easily inserted, the immortal ink can be easily inserted, the amount of use can be reduced, and the effect of accurately supplying the immortal ink to the pad can be improved.

また、本考案の請求項2の不滅インクを用いた手動捺印用スタンプによれば、周縁突出面の形成とパッドの挿入端側の端面との位置関係により平面度の多少劣る印刷面への捺印が正確に行われ、捺印可能な対象への自由度の向上が図られる。   According to the stamp for manual stamping using immortal ink according to claim 2 of the present invention, the stamping on the printing surface having a slightly inferior flatness due to the positional relationship between the formation of the peripheral protrusion surface and the end surface of the pad on the insertion end side. Is performed accurately, and the degree of freedom for objects that can be stamped is improved.

また、本考案の請求項3の不滅インクを用いた手動捺印用スタンプによれば、キャップの存在により不滅インクの流出が防止されると共にスタンプ全体の汚れが防止され、寿命の向上が図られる。   Further, according to the stamp for manual stamping using immortal ink according to claim 3 of the present invention, the presence of the cap prevents the immortal ink from flowing out, prevents the entire stamp from being stained, and improves the life.

以下、本考案の不滅インクを用いた手動捺印用スタンプの実施の形態を図面を参照して詳述する。   Hereinafter, an embodiment of a stamp for manual stamping using immortal ink according to the present invention will be described in detail with reference to the drawings.

図1は本考案の不滅インクを用いた手動捺印用スタンプ100の外観構造を示すものであり、一点鎖線はキャップ3を示すものである。この不滅インクを用いた手動捺印用スタンプ100は大別して印字側ホルダ1とこれが挿入保持される保持側ホルダ2と前記したキャップ3等とからなり、キャップ3は保持側ホルダ2に着脱可能に螺着され印字側ホルダ1を被包し不滅インクの流出を防止し、印字側ホルダ1を保護する役目を果すものからなる。また、図2は図1のA矢視の側面図であり、印字側ホルダ1の端面構造を示すものからなる。この端面構造は捺印用のパッド4(図3に示す)が挿入されるパッド挿入保持孔部5と円周に沿って突出形成される周縁突出面6が形成されている。捺印時には例えばキャップ3を取り外し保持側ホルダ2を指でつまんだ形で周縁突出面6及びパッド4を被捺印部19に当てて行う。なお、パッド4はパッド挿入保持孔部5に挿入可能のものがすべてセットされることは勿論であり、この挿脱は例えばピンセット等により行う。   FIG. 1 shows an external structure of a manual stamp 100 using immortal ink according to the present invention, and a one-dot chain line shows a cap 3. The manual stamping stamp 100 using immortal ink is roughly divided into a printing side holder 1, a holding side holder 2 into which the printing side holder 1 is inserted and held, the cap 3 and the like. The cap 3 is detachably screwed to the holding side holder 2. The printing-side holder 1 is encapsulated to prevent the immortal ink from flowing out and to protect the printing-side holder 1. FIG. 2 is a side view taken along arrow A in FIG. 1 and shows an end surface structure of the printing side holder 1. This end face structure is formed with a pad insertion holding hole portion 5 into which a pad 4 for marking (shown in FIG. 3) is inserted and a peripheral protrusion surface 6 protruding along the circumference. At the time of stamping, for example, the cap 3 is removed and the holding holder 2 is pinched with a finger so that the peripheral protruding surface 6 and the pad 4 are applied to the stamped portion 19. Of course, all the pads 4 that can be inserted into the pad insertion holding hole 5 are set, and this insertion / removal is performed by tweezers, for example.

次に、図3乃至図7により不滅インクを用いた手動捺印用スタンプ100の詳細構造を説明する。   Next, the detailed structure of the manual stamp 100 using immortal ink will be described with reference to FIGS.

図3は印字側ホルダ1を示す軸断面図である。印字側ホルダ1は外径d1,d2,d3(d1<d2<d3)の3段構造からなり、外径d3の円筒の端面には前記した周縁突出面6とパッド4を挿入するパッド挿入保持孔部5が形成されている。また、d2の円筒には図7に示すような多数個の突出部7が等ピッチで突出形成されている。
また、印字側ホルダ1はその内部に内径D1の孔8とこれに連通する内径D2(D2>D1)の穴9とこの穴9に連通して端面側に開口されてる前記のパッド挿入保持孔部5が設けられている。
内径D2の穴9には孔8から注入された不滅インク10を湿った状態で保持するインクパッド11が収納され、このインクパッド11はパッド4に接触して配置される。
FIG. 3 is an axial sectional view showing the printing side holder 1. The print-side holder 1 has a three-stage structure with outer diameters d1, d2 and d3 (d1 <d2 <d3), and a pad insertion holding for inserting the above-described peripheral protrusion surface 6 and pad 4 on the end surface of the cylinder with the outer diameter d3. A hole 5 is formed. Further, a large number of projecting portions 7 as shown in FIG. 7 are formed on the cylinder d2 so as to project at an equal pitch.
Further, the printing side holder 1 has a hole 8 with an inner diameter D1 therein, a hole 9 with an inner diameter D2 (D2> D1) communicating therewith, and the pad insertion holding hole communicating with the hole 9 and opened on the end face side. Part 5 is provided.
An ink pad 11 for holding the immortal ink 10 injected from the hole 8 in a damp state is accommodated in the hole 9 having the inner diameter D2, and the ink pad 11 is disposed in contact with the pad 4.

図4は保持側ホルダ2の詳細構造を示す。保持側ホルダ2は外径d4(d4≒d3)のストレートの略円筒部12からなるが、その先端側には外径d5(d5>d4)のはね上り部13が形成されると共にねじ部14が形成される略円筒体からなり、その内部には前記の印字側ホルダ1の外径d1の部分が挿入される内径D3の穴15及び印字側ホルダ1の外径d2の部分が挿入される内径D4の穴16が形成される。なお、保持側ホルダ2の前記の穴15及び穴16の軸線方向の深さは図3に示した印字側ホルダ1の外径d1及び外径d2の部分の軸線方向の長さと略等しい形状のものからなる(図3及び図4においてm,nで示す)。   FIG. 4 shows a detailed structure of the holding side holder 2. The holding-side holder 2 is composed of a straight substantially cylindrical portion 12 having an outer diameter d4 (d4≈d3), and a protruding portion 13 having an outer diameter d5 (d5> d4) is formed at the tip side and a screw portion. 14 is formed in a substantially cylindrical body into which the hole 15 having an inner diameter D3 into which the portion of the outer diameter d1 of the printing side holder 1 is inserted and the portion of the outer diameter d2 of the printing side holder 1 are inserted. A hole 16 having an inner diameter D4 is formed. Note that the axial depths of the holes 15 and 16 of the holding-side holder 2 are substantially equal to the axial lengths of the outer diameter d1 and outer diameter d2 portions of the printing-side holder 1 shown in FIG. (Indicated by m and n in FIGS. 3 and 4).

以上の構造の印字側ホルダ1は保持側ホルダ2の穴15及び穴16に外径d1及び外径d2の部分を挿入した状態で組み付けられるが、外径d2の部分の突出部7が保持側ホルダ2の穴16の内面に強く接触するため保持側ホルダ1は保持側ホルダ2に挿入された状態で抜け出すことなく保持される。しかしながら、穴16と突出部7との挿圧力は突出部7の部位では高いがその他の部分は穴16に接触していないため印字側ホルダ1は保持側ホルダ2に対して少量ではあるが首振り可能に保持される。   The printing side holder 1 having the above structure is assembled with the outer diameter d1 and the outer diameter d2 inserted into the holes 15 and 16 of the holding side holder 2, but the protruding portion 7 of the outer diameter d2 is the holding side. Since the holder 2 is in strong contact with the inner surface of the hole 16 of the holder 2, the holder 1 is held without being pulled out while being inserted into the holder 2. However, the insertion pressure between the hole 16 and the protruding portion 7 is high at the portion of the protruding portion 7, but the other portion is not in contact with the hole 16. Holds swingable.

図5はキャップ3の詳細構造を示すものである。キャップ3は印字側ホルダ1を被包する内径の穴17と保持側ホルダ2のねじ部14に螺合するねじ穴18を開口形成する筒体からなり、保持側ホルダ2に挿入された印字側ホルダ1を被包すると共に挿入された状態に印字側ホルダ1を保持する機能を有するものからなり、不使用時に組み付けられるものからなり捺印時には取り外される。   FIG. 5 shows the detailed structure of the cap 3. The cap 3 is formed of a cylindrical body having an inner diameter hole 17 that encloses the printing side holder 1 and a screw hole 18 that is screwed into the screw portion 14 of the holding side holder 2, and the printing side inserted into the holding side holder 2. The holder 1 is encapsulated and has a function of holding the printing side holder 1 in the inserted state. The holder 1 is assembled when not in use, and is removed at the time of printing.

以上の構造の不滅インクを用いた手動捺印用スタンプ100により被捺印部19に捺印を行うには、キャップ3を取り外した状態で保持側ホルダ2の円筒部12を指で保持した状態で印字側ホルダ1のパッド4を被捺印部19側に押圧して行う。孔8に注入された不滅インク10はインクパッド11を介してパッド4に供給されているため、被捺印部19にパッド4が接触することにより所望の捺印が行われることになる。
なお、図8に示すように被捺印部19に対して不滅インクを用いた手動捺印用スタンプ100が少し傾斜して接触する場合でも周縁突出面6の形成と突出部7の存在により傾斜が修正されてパッド4が被捺印部19に全面的に当るようになるため正確な捺印が行われることになる。即ち、被捺印部19の平面度が少し悪い場合でもパッド4による捺印が正確に行われることになる。
In order to print the stamped portion 19 with the stamp 100 for manual marking using immortal ink having the above structure, the cylindrical portion 12 of the holding-side holder 2 is held with a finger while the cap 3 is removed. This is performed by pressing the pad 4 of the holder 1 toward the part to be marked 19. Since the immortal ink 10 injected into the hole 8 is supplied to the pad 4 via the ink pad 11, the desired marking is performed when the pad 4 comes into contact with the portion to be marked 19.
As shown in FIG. 8, even when the manual stamp 100 using immortal ink comes into contact with the part 19 to be imprinted with a slight inclination, the inclination is corrected by the formation of the peripheral protrusion surface 6 and the presence of the protrusion 7. As a result, the pad 4 comes into full contact with the portion to be marked 19 so that accurate marking is performed. That is, even when the flatness of the portion to be marked 19 is slightly poor, the marking by the pad 4 is performed accurately.

図8は捺印が手打ちの場合を示すものであるが図9は本考案の不滅インクを用いた手動捺印用スタンプ100をサポータ20によって捺印装置側21に取り付け、サポータ20を図略の捺印装置側21に固定して捺印を行う場合を示す。この場合でも前記と同様に被捺印部19の平面度が多少悪くても正確な捺印を行うことができる。   FIG. 8 shows a case where the stamping is hand-printed, but FIG. 9 shows that the manual stamping stamp 100 using the immortal ink of the present invention is attached to the stamping device side 21 by the supporter 20, and the supporter 20 is not shown. A case where the marking is fixed to 21 is shown. Even in this case, as described above, accurate marking can be performed even if the flatness of the portion to be marked 19 is somewhat poor.

本考案の不滅インクを用いた手動捺印用スタンプ100は以上の構造からなり、捺印が正確に行われると共に不滅インク10の使用により捺印が簡単には消えない特徴を有するものからなる。
なお、本考案の不滅インクを用いた手動捺印用スタンプ100は以上の説明の内容のものからなるが、この内容のものに限定されるものではなく同一技術的範疇のものが適用されることは勿論である。
The stamp 100 for manual stamping using immortal ink according to the present invention has the above-described structure, and is characterized in that the stamping is performed accurately and the stamping is not easily erased by using the immortal ink 10.
The manual stamp 100 using immortal ink according to the present invention is composed of the contents described above, but is not limited to the contents described above, and those of the same technical category can be applied. Of course.

本考案の不滅インクを用いた手動捺印用スタンプは任意の形態のパッドの挿入が可能であり、印刷される字数や形態についても各種のものが用いられるためその使用範囲は広い。また、コンパクトにまとめられたものからなり携帯が容易であり、便利に使用されるため利用度は極めて広い。   The stamp for manual stamping using the immortal ink of the present invention can be inserted in any form of pad, and since various kinds of printed characters and forms are used, the range of use is wide. Moreover, since it is compactly packed, it is easy to carry and is used conveniently, so the utilization is extremely wide.
